Early Life & Education
Dr. Raunaque Sidana was born on 12 August 1967 in Bhopal, Madhya Pradesh. Alongside his studies, he grew up to have a strong interest in art, music, and performance, all of which served as the cornerstones of his diverse career.
He started his early schooling at Campion School in Bhopal, where he was involved in extracurricular activities like sports, music, and theater. Later, he relocated to the esteemed Daly College in Indore, which is among the oldest public schools in India. There, his artistic and leadership abilities flourished even more.
In order to further his education, he enrolled at Yeshwantrao Chavan College of Engineering in Nagpur, where he was able to complement his artistic endeavors with technical knowledge and discipline. Social Campaigns and Riding
Dr. Sidana, also known as "The Soul Rider," advocates for conscious riding as a way to raise social consciousness. He has driven his Royal Enfield Thunderbird Twinspark more than one million kilometers throughout India since 2010. He broke records with long-distance campaigns like the Beach Warrior challenge, which involved cleaning seven beaches in seven days, and the Pirate Rider ride (10,077 km), which raised awareness of eye care. Along with famous rides like the Jyotirlinga Yatra, One Ride, Motoverse, and the Spirit of Independence Ride, his travels have taken him through Leh-Ladakh, the Spiti Valley, coastal India, the Rajasthani deserts, and the Maharashtra forts.

Yoga and Wellness Work
Dr. Sidana is the founder of Dr. Raunaque’s Yoga, with centers in Mumbai and Bhopal. Having taught yoga for more than 20 years, he has trained thousands of students and set multiple world records. He has received notable accolades for his work, including the Yoga Shastri Award (2025), the Holistic Healer Excellence Award (2024), and the Yoga Vajra Award (2023, 2024, and 2025). With international certification in a variety of fields, such as corporate yoga, aerial yoga, face yoga, chair yoga, chakra healing, medical yoga therapy, sound healing, and prenatal yoga, he never stops inspiring with his all-encompassing style. Notably, he has also broken records by leading more than 1,000 students in a mass yoga session on International Yoga Day 2025 at Aksa Beach in Mumbai and completing 16 asanas in 20 minutes during Yoga on the Boat at Dana Pani Beach in Mumbai.
